Behind every great restaurant is a place most guests never see: the dish pit. In this episode, we dive into the fast paced, high pressure world of dishwashers-the people who keep service moving when the tickets won't stop coming. From mountains of plates and clattering pans to teamwork, grit, and pure endurance, dishwashers are the backbone of every kitchen. We talk about why the dish pit is one of the toughest jobs in the building, how it teaches discipline and hustle, and why so many great employees, managers, chefs, and restaurant owners started there. This is a tribute to the unsung heroes who keep the whole operation alive- one rack at a time.

Rilla Fest 2026 #Rillage

This week, we're talking about a night that meant so much more than just great music and a packed house. We came together to celebrate the life and legacy of Christine Havrilla - an incredible local musician who left a lasting mark on everyone lucky enough to know her sound and her spirit. The Rillage - her devoted circle of fans, family, and friends - showed up in full force to support the newly created memorial scholarship fund in her name. And that's the thing about fundraisers: they're never just about the money. They're about preserving legacies. They're about community showing up. They're about turning grief into something hopeful and lasting. We talk about what it takes to host a meaningful fundraiser, the emotional weight behind events like this, and why people give - not out of obligation, but out of love. When the room is filled with shared memories, music, and purpose, something bigger happens. It becomes impact. It was powerful, emotional, loud (in the best way), and exactly the kind of night she would've loved. Because when the Rillage packs the house, it's not just an event - it's a movement.
